net: ipv6: fix NOREF dst use in seg6 and rpl lwtunnels
CVE-2026-46099 addresses a vulnerability related to the handling of NOREF destination use in IPv6 Segment Routing (seg6) and RPL lightweight tunnels within Microsoft and Azure Linux 3. 0 environments. The provided description does not include technical details or impact specifics beyond the mention of the affected components. No CVSS score or detailed exploitation information is available. There is no indication of known exploits in the wild or patch availability at this time.
